At its core, romantic drama is built on empathy. Unlike high-octane action films or mind-bending science fiction, these narratives rely almost entirely on the internal lives of their characters. When we watch two people navigate the treacherous waters of miscommunication, societal barriers, or unrequited affection, we are not just passive observers. We are actively reflecting on our own lives, relationships, and hidden desires.

Love, loss, and longing are universal human experiences. A romantic drama produced in South Korea (K-Drama) or Turkey (Dizi) easily transcends linguistic borders, finding massive audiences in South America, Europe, and North America with minimal cultural translation required.
